/* Just test which direction the stack grows in this arch/ABI
Kind of a big deal when deciding which end of the stack to
pass as a pointer to clone :-)
*/
#include <stdio.h>
void func (int* f1) {
int f2;
printf("Addr frame 1 = %llx, Addr frame 2 = %llx\n", f1, &f2);
if (&f2 > f1) {
printf("Stack grows up (and this threading library needs to be fixed for your arch...)\n");
} else {
printf("Stack grows down\n");
}
}
int main (int argc, char**argv) {
int f1;
func(&f1);
}
